
Sporting KC Hires Nate Bukaty as Play-By-Play Announcer

Sporting Kansas City announced today that Nate Bukaty has been hired as the club's play-by-play announcer for the 2015 season. Bukaty will take over the role as the lead voice of Sporting KC on locally televised matches and select radio broadcasts.
"I'm very excited for this opportunity," Bukaty said. "As a Kansas City native and local soccer fan, I vividly remember attending professional indoor soccer games as a kid. I've witnessed the exponential growth of soccer in this city over the past 20 years and I'm excited to be in the thick of it. It's a dream come true to work for Sporting Kansas City, calling a sport that I love."
Over the past four years, Bukaty has been actively involved in Sporting Kansas City broadcasts on TV and radio. In 2010, he hosted the Kansas City Soccer Show on 810 WHB. In 2012 and 2013, Bukaty attended and covered the club's preseason campaign in Orlando, Florida. Bukaty also served as a sideline reporter for SKCTV Network during the 2013 MLS Cup Playoffs and was 810 WHB's play-by-play announcer for Sporting KC home matches during the 2014 season.
Bukaty graduated from the University of Kansas in 1998 with a bachelor's degree in journalism. The Kansas City native has more than 15 years of experience working in radio and television including longtime roles with the Jayhawks Radio and TV Networks. Bukaty has served as the play-by-play voice for the Kansas women's basketball team for the past 14 years and a sideline commentator for Kansas football since 2006.
Since 2007, Bukaty has co-hosted The Border Patrol on Sports Radio 810-WHB. Bukaty previously worked on the Royals Radio Network, leading the Kansas City Royals pregame and postgame coverage. Bukaty also served as a clubhouse reporter for Royals television broadcasts on Fox Sports Kansas City.
In addition to calling locally broadcast Sporting KC games in 2015, Bukaty will call select games on radio and host the club's weekly radio show.
Jake Yadrich, who worked last year as the Ivy Funds sideline reporter for SKCTV Network, will remain on the broadcast team in 2015. Callum Williams and Diego Gutierrez, who in 2014 served as play-by-play announcer and color commentator, respectively, will not be back in 2015. Future additions to the broadcast team will be announced at a later date.
